Our Monaco vs Olimpia Milano prediction centers on a crucial Euroleague clash at Monaco Arena where both teams fight for playoff positioning. Monaco (17-14, 8th place) holds the final play-in spot while Milano (16-15, 12th) desperately needs points to stay in contention. The bookmaker consensus favors Milano as slight away favorites at 52.7% probability, but Monaco's superior home form (10-5 vs Milano's 6-8 away record) creates compelling NBA picks value. Monaco averages 95.5 points at home compared to Milano's 83.2 on the road, suggesting the hosts' offensive advantage could be decisive. Both teams enter well-rested with 10 and 8 days respectively since their last games, eliminating fatigue concerns. Milano's recent Euroleague form shows promise with wins over Maccabi Tel Aviv and Barcelona, while Monaco has struggled lately, losing to Nancy domestically but defeating Olympiacos in their last Euroleague outing. The head-to-head record splits 2-2 in recent meetings, with Monaco winning the most recent encounter 82-79 away. Expert picks favor Monaco's home court advantage in this basketball betting tips scenario, particularly given Milano's road struggles and the pressure of needing every point for playoff qualification.

Recent head-to-head meetings show a competitive rivalry with Monaco holding a slight edge in the last four encounters (2-2 split, but Monaco won the most recent meeting 82-79 in Milano). The series has featured low-scoring affairs, with totals ranging from 145-193 points. Monaco has dominated at home historically, winning their last three home meetings against Milano. Milano's lone recent home victory came in February 2025 (86-80), but they've struggled to replicate that success on Monaco's court. The average combined score in recent H2H meetings is 161 points, well below both teams' season averages.

Monaco sits precariously in 8th place with a 17-14 record, clinging to the final play-in tournament spot. Their home form has been their saving grace, posting a solid 10-5 record at Monaco Arena while averaging 95.5 points per game. However, recent form raises concerns as they've lost three of their last five games, including a shocking 94-86 defeat to Nancy in domestic competition. The positive is their last Euroleague performance - a crucial 81-80 victory over second-placed Olympiacos that demonstrated their ability to rise for big occasions. With 10 days of rest, Monaco should be physically fresh, but they face significant injury concerns with key players like Nick Calathes and Nikola Mirotic listed as out. Their offensive efficiency at home (95.5 PPG) compared to their road struggles (84.4 PPG) highlights the importance of home court advantage.

Olimpia Milano enters this crucial fixture in 12th place with a 16-15 record, four points behind Monaco and desperately needing victories to maintain playoff hopes. Their away form has been problematic all season, managing just 6-8 on the road while averaging only 83.2 points per game - a significant drop from their 87.8 home average. Recent Euroleague form shows improvement with impressive home victories over Maccabi Tel Aviv (96-87) and Barcelona (87-84), demonstrating their capability against quality opposition. However, road struggles persist, highlighted by recent defeats to Hapoel Tel-Aviv and Dubai. Milano's injury list is extensive, with Lorenzo Brown and several rotation players sidelined. Their upcoming fixture congestion (back-to-back games after this match) could impact preparation and focus. The pressure is immense as they cannot afford many more defeats in their playoff chase.
